How do I install FrontPage extensions on the Aplus.Net Control Panel?

Answer by: Stuart Pierce, Aplus.Net Knowledge Base Support

Microsoft FrontPage Server Extensions are the server-side companion to the MS FrontPage client program. They provide authoring and administrative functions to web authors through the MS FrontPage client and dynamic content to web users through the browser.

You will need to install MS FrontPage Extensions for any website that you want to edit using MS FrontPage. Please have in mind that once the FP Extensions are installed, you cannot upload your website files with a regular FTP client – you have to use only the MS FrontPage software for this purpose.

HOW TO INSTALL THE FRONTPAGE EXTENSIONS:

  1. Start by logging into the Aplus.Net Control Panel at http://cp.aplus.net using your Registration Number and Customer Password.
  2. Select Web Hosting from the top navigation bar.
  3. Next, select Hosted Domains and click on Manage Hosted Domains.
  4. Now, select the hosted domain that you’d like to manage.
  5. Click the MS FrontPage Manager icon.

Important: It is possible, if you have a Unix-based hosting plan, that you will now see a warning message that the FP Extensions could not be installed due to the existence of .htaccess files in your web space. A lot of tools available in the Control Panel use .htaccess files, for example the Protect Directories, Custom Error Pages, Redirect URL, MIME Types, Advanced Forum, Wiki, osCommerce, etc. Click the Rename Files button to rename your existing .htaccess files to .htaccess-orig. Once the FP extensions are installed, you will be able to automatically rename back the files with a Restore Files button. Please have in mind though, that an .htaccess file located in your main web directory will not be renamed back because it interferes with a certain .htaccess file used by the FP extensions.

  1. Click the Install button.
